As a Plainfield homeowner, what are my biggest plumbing risks?
In this suburban setting, the primary risks come from the municipal infrastructure meeting your property. Shifts in municipal water pressure can stress older plumbing joints. Furthermore, while you're on a sewer main, tree roots seeking moisture in the plain soil are a constant threat to your underground service lateral, often requiring professional jetting or repair.

Could the flat land here cause drainage problems for my house?
The plain terrain around Lake Renwick Preserve means natural drainage gradients are minimal. This can put constant, low-grade stress on your main sewer line as it relies entirely on proper pitch to move waste. Over time, soil settling can create a belly or low spot in the line, leading to recurrent clogs and backups.
What's the most important cold-weather plumbing tip for Plainfield?
Before temperatures hit that 15°F low, disconnect and drain your outdoor hoses. A more critical pro-tip for our temperate climate is to know where your main water shut-off valve is. A pipe that freezes and bursts during a spring thaw can flood a home in minutes; being able to stop the water immediately is essential.

Do I need a permit to replace my water heater or re-pipe my house?
Most major plumbing work in Plainfield requires a permit from the Plainfield Building Department, and installations must meet Illinois Department of Public Health codes. Does our hard water from Lake Michigan damage plumbing?
Yes, the mineral content in Lake Michigan water leads to significant scale buildup. This limescale acts as an insulator inside water heaters, forcing them to work harder and fail sooner. On fixtures and inside pipes, it restricts flow and can trap corrosion, accelerating wear on valves and aerators.
Why are my copper pipes suddenly leaking after 20 years?
Copper pipes installed around 2002 are susceptible to pinhole leaks caused by a combination of factors. Local water chemistry can accelerate internal corrosion, and the soldered joints can become points of failure as they age and calcify. This isn't a defect, but a predictable lifespan issue for this generation of plumbing.
